Financial Stability Board Emphasizes Need for Global Crypto Regulation to Prevent Arbitrage

The Financial Stability Board (FSB) Plenary met in Toronto on June 14 to discuss various financial stability issues. Key topics included the financial stability outlook, lessons from the March 2023 banking turmoil, and enhancing the resilience of non-bank financial intermediation (NBFI). The FSB also reviewed progress on implementing its global regulatory framework for crypto asset activities. Members emphasized the need for broad global implementation to mitigate regulatory arbitrage risks in the crypto space, particularly in emerging markets and developing economies (EMDEs). Additionally, the FSB addressed the challenges posed by global stablecoin arrangements in these regions and discussed the impact of nature-related financial risks.
